MACRO chosen by BOC Medical for range of forthcoming studies
Today InferMed is pleased to announce that BOC Medical has selected InferMed’s electronic data collection (EDC) solution MACRO for use in its programme of clinical studies of medical gases and their use in the treatment of respiratory diseases.
BOC Medical is a discrete strategic business unit within the larger BOC Group. Everything from the design of products, to the way in which they are delivered, is unique to BOC Medical and it has a distinct market presence. The product range is designed and sold with patients in mind and the company works in conjunction with local health trusts and health professionals to deliver these products to hospitals.
BOC Medical has a full programme of clinical research to which the implementation of MACRO will add electronic data collection capability. About BOC Medical
Over 600 hospitals in the UK rely on BOC Medical (www.bocmedical.co.uk) products to provide crucial care to their patients. BOC Medical also provides home care products, improving the quality of life for thousands of people in their own home. BOC Medical’s hospital range includes many types of medical gases, used in nearly every department, from nitrous oxide for use in anaesthesia, to helium for cooling magnets in MRI scanners
